Dear Teachers:

Be advised that the formerly named Shenzhen Nanshan Bilingual School is going by a new name:

Nanshan Chinese International College

Anyone doing research on this school should know the history. Shenzhen Nashan Bilingual School and Nanshan Chinese International College are the same school.
